&lt;P&gt;It is not clear from the screenshot about how you are printing the catalog. Is it a SAS session, some stored process report from FS or something else.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;The list shows contents of a catalog which is present inside the SAS library COMIT. From SAS 9.4 explorer you can explore the content of the library.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&lt;span class="lia-inline-image-display-wrapper lia-image-align-inline" image-alt="Screenshot 2025-02-13 204633.png" style="width: 200px;"&gt;&lt;img src="https://communities.sas.com/t5/image/serverpage/image-id/104611i35BF7DE24709B787/image-size/small?v=v2&amp;amp;px=200" role="button" title="Screenshot 2025-02-13 204633.png" alt="Screenshot 2025-02-13 204633.png" /&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Once you are able to locate the catalog CUST_REPO, you can double click to open it.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&lt;span class="lia-inline-image-display-wrapper lia-image-align-inline" image-alt="Screenshot 2025-02-13 205055.png" style="width: 200px;"&gt;&lt;img src="https://communities.sas.com/t5/image/serverpage/image-id/104612i7F0CF47AA465CA60/image-size/small?v=v2&amp;amp;px=200" role="button" title="Screenshot 2025-02-13 205055.png" alt="Screenshot 2025-02-13 205055.png" /&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;You can access the same catalog file in the filesystem:&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&lt;span class="lia-inline-image-display-wrapper lia-image-align-inline" image-alt="Screenshot 2025-02-13 205243.png" style="width: 400px;"&gt;&lt;img src="https://communities.sas.com/t5/image/serverpage/image-id/104613i490BA51BB2C51615/image-size/medium?v=v2&amp;amp;px=400" role="button" title="Screenshot 2025-02-13 205243.png" alt="Screenshot 2025-02-13 205243.png" /&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;To work (modify) such model repository catalogs, you may need to use SAS CATALOG &amp;amp; REPOSITORY procedures.&lt;/P&gt;
